Hey Marit — handing off the user-module split before I'm out next week. I've carved auth and profile endpoints out of the Brontle monolith into the new Userhive service; sessions still proxy through the old path until we flip the flag. Tests pass locally and on staging. Main thing to review is the routing shim in gateway.py. The service reads its settings from the values below.

deployment values, kagaf-kahag:
[prawyn]
port = 6379
region = east-2
host = prawyn.qirvanlabs.corp
timeout_ms = 750
retries = 1

Q: How do I regenerate signing certs for Inkbill, the PDF invoice renderer?

Short answer: you usually don't — the Draywick cert bot handles rotation. But if the bot dies mid-rotation (happened twice this quarter), you'll need to unlock the cert vault manually and rerun the rotation script from tools/rotate.sh. Ping whoever's on call first so we don't double-rotate. The vault unlock prompt asks for the team recovery passphrase, which for convenience is:

recovery phrase for bawip-tawip: wenix-praion

Plugin authors should develop exclusively against sandbox, which mirrors production schemas but uses synthetic dock data for the fictional city of Marrowvale. Staging is reserved for certified plugins awaiting promotion; writes there are audited. Rate limits differ per environment, so never assume sandbox behavior carries over. Each environment exposes its own endpoint set and quota tier. The sandbox configuration values are as follows.

config for bajop-kajop:
QUENIX_PIN=6188
QUENIX_METRICS_HOST=metrics.quenix.nelvrosys.corp
QUENIX_LOG_LEVEL=debug
QUENIX_TENANT=joreth